Being a wrestler runs in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son's family.

Simone Johnson, the pro wrestler-turned-daughter, actor's has just announced her pro wrestler identity ahead of her World Wrestling Entertainment (WWE) debut.

The 20-year-old has been training for her debut for nearly two years, and despite her young age, she is apparently trying to follow in her father's footsteps.

Simone will be the fourth generation on her father's side, and she has declared that she will be known in WWE as Ava Raine.

She revealed it on Instagram and even changed her Twitter handle to the pseudonym.

The athlete's announcement comes after she first inked a contract with WWE in early 2020.

Her debut was apparently delayed due to injuries that required surgery; however, Simon is now fully prepared to go, with the full backing of her renowned father as well.

In a social media post, the "Jumanji" actor gushed about his daughter's decision to follow in his footsteps, saying, "First and foremost, what an honor that my daughter wants to follow in my footsteps, but more importantly, follow in my footsteps sounds cliché, but she wants to create and blaze her path, which is so important."

Dwayne Johnson's father, Rocky "Soulman" Johnson, and great-grandfather, Peter "High Chief" Maivia, were both professional wrestlers long before he joined WWE.

However, Simone's decision was not without criticism.

She faced hostility and parallels to her wealthy relatives, but the upcoming pro-wrestler spoke out and stated unequivocally that she intended to make it in the profession.

Simone Johnson earlier stated in a tweet, "I don't get why people being depicted as different persons from their family name is such a contentious matter."

"A name does not negate any earlier achievements from any family."

Simone also said that she had wanted to be a wrestler since she was a child, claiming that she had fell in love with the sport when she was a toddler.

She is the daughter of Dwayne and Dany Garcia, his ex-wife.

Aside from Simone, The Rock has two additional children with his wife, Lauren Hashian: Jasmine, six, and Tiana, four.

Dwayne is still one of the most infamous names in wrestling and is recognized for his skills even after quitting in 2004.

But these days, he can be seen in a variety of films, including "Baywatch," lending his voice to "Moana," and even working in business.
